
2025 ავტორი: Lynn Donovan | [email protected]. ბოლოს შეცვლილი: 2025-01-22 17:29
AWS აქვს CI / CD ლურსმნებიანი. სიცხადისთვის, CI / CD ნიშნავს უწყვეტ ინტეგრაციას, უწყვეტ მიწოდებას. მარტივად რომ ვთქვათ, თუ გაქვთ ა CI / CD მილსადენი , როდესაც კოდს თქვენს საცავში აყენებთ, ის ავტომატურად შეადგენს და დააინსტალირებს თქვენს პროგრამულ უზრუნველყოფას თქვენს განვითარების გარემოში.
ამის გათვალისწინებით, როგორ ქმნით CI CD მილსადენს AWS-ში?
თქვენი პროგრამული უზრუნველყოფის მიწოდების პროცესის ავტომატიზაცია უწყვეტი ინტეგრაციისა და მიწოდების (CI/CD) მილსადენების გამოყენებით
- შექმენით გამოშვების მილსადენი, რომელიც ავტომატიზირებს თქვენი პროგრამული უზრუნველყოფის მიწოდების პროცესს AWS CodePipeline-ის გამოყენებით.
- შეაერთეთ წყაროს საცავი, როგორიცაა AWS CodeCommit, Amazon S3 ან GitHub, თქვენს მილსადენს.
ანალოგიურად, რას ნიშნავს CI CD? CI / CD . Ვიკიპედიიდან, უფასო ენციკლოპედიიდან. პროგრამული უზრუნველყოფის ინჟინერიაში, CI / CD ან CICD ზოგადად ეხება უწყვეტი ინტეგრაციისა და უწყვეტი მიწოდების ან უწყვეტი განლაგების კომბინირებულ პრაქტიკას.
შემდეგ, როგორ მუშაობს CI CD მილსადენი?
Ერთად CI / CD მილსადენი , ყოველ ჯერზე, როდესაც პროგრამული უზრუნველყოფის კოდი იცვლება, ის ავტომატურად აგებულია და ტესტირება ხდება. კოდის ანალიზი ეწინააღმდეგება მას. თუ ის გაივლის ხარისხის კონტროლის კარიბჭეს და გაივლის ყველა ტესტი, ის ავტომატურად განლაგდება, სადაც მის წინააღმდეგ ავტომატური მიღების ტესტები გადის.
რა არის CI CD ტექნოლოგიები?
CI / CD ეს არის კლიენტებისთვის აპლიკაციების ხშირად მიწოდების მეთოდი აპლიკაციის განვითარების ეტაპებზე ავტომატიზაციის დანერგვით. კონკრეტულად, CI / CD წარმოგიდგენთ მუდმივ ავტომატიზაციას და უწყვეტ მონიტორინგს აპლიკაციების სასიცოცხლო ციკლის განმავლობაში, ინტეგრაციისა და ტესტირების ფაზებიდან მიწოდებამდე და განთავსებამდე.
გირჩევთ:
რა არის მსუბუქი გადასატანი ჯენკინსის მილსადენი?

Jenkins Pipeline დანამატს აქვს ფუნქცია, რომელიც ცნობილია როგორც „მსუბუქი შეკვეთა“, სადაც მასტერი მხოლოდ Jenkinsfile-ს ამოიღებს რეპოდან, მთლიანი რეპოსგან განსხვავებით. კონფიგურაციის ეკრანზე არის შესაბამისი ჩამრთველი
როგორ შევქმნა AWS მილსადენი?

შედით AWS Management Console-ში და გახსენით CodePipeline კონსოლი მისამართზე http://console.aws.amazon.com/codesuite/codepipeline/home. მისასალმებელი გვერდზე აირჩიეთ მილსადენის შექმნა. ნაბიჯი 1: აირჩიეთ მილსადენის პარამეტრების გვერდი, Pipeline name-ში შეიყვანეთ თქვენი მილსადენის სახელი. სერვისის როლში, გააკეთეთ ერთ-ერთი შემდეგი:
რა არის განვითარების მილსადენი?

Ვიკიპედიიდან, უფასო ენციკლოპედიიდან. პროდუქტის მილსადენი არის პროდუქტების სერია, განვითარების, მომზადების ან წარმოების მდგომარეობაში, შემუშავებული და გაყიდული კომპანიის მიერ და იდეალურ შემთხვევაში მათი სასიცოცხლო ციკლის სხვადასხვა ეტაპზე
რა არის Azure DevOps მილსადენი?

Azure Pipelines არის უწყვეტი მიწოდების ინსტრუმენტი, რომელიც კონკურენციას უწევს ინსტრუმენტებს, როგორიცაა ღია კოდის Jenkins. სხვა CI/CD სისტემების მსგავსად, ის ასევე გაფართოებულია, ამოცანებისა და გაფართოებების ბიბლიოთეკით, რათა დაემატოს სატესტო ხელსაწყოს მხარდაჭერა და ინტეგრაცია თქვენს devops ხელსაწყოების ჯაჭვთან
რა არის CI და CD მილსადენი?

CI/CD მილსადენის დანერგვა, ან უწყვეტი ინტეგრაცია/უწყვეტი განლაგება, არის თანამედროვე DevOps გარემოს საფუძველი. ის ახდენს უფსკრული განვითარებისა და ოპერაციების გუნდებს შორის აპლიკაციების შენობის, ტესტირებისა და განლაგების ავტომატიზაციის გზით